水下航行器新型凸轮发动机的机械效率分析

摘    要:凸轮发动机的机械效率是影响其动力性指标和经济性指标的一项重要参数。为了对新型凸轮发动机的机械效率进行分析,在分析新型凸轮发动机活塞受力的基础上,研究了新型凸轮发动机各运动副之间的摩擦损失,对新型凸轮发动机机械效率进行了估算。本文的方法可为活塞凸轮发动机的机械效率的计算提供参考。

Mechanical efficiency analyzing for a new type underwater vehicle cam engine

Abstract:Mechanical efficiency of cam engine is important for its power performance and economy performance.In order to analyze the mechanical efficiency of a new type cam engine,the friction losses of each kinematic pair are researched based on analyzing the force on piston of a new type cam engine,and the mechanical efficiency of a new type cam engine is computed.The models in paper can be referred for computing cam engine.
